Stefan Istrate
@stef2n
Romania
Joined Dec 2006
World Rank: #12299 (2.8 points)
Institution: University of Bucharest
Activity over the last year
Effectiveness
- Problems solved
- 18
- Solutions submitted
- 230
Romania
Joined Dec 2006
World Rank: #12299 (2.8 points)
Institution: University of Bucharest